Successful Scaling With Jessica Wine

22m · Published 01 Mar 05:00
Jessica Wine is the Area Vice President of Enterprise Sales at OwnBackup, a leading cloud-to-cloud backup and recovery, archiving, and sandbox seeding vendor. In this episode, co-hosts Jeremey Donovan and Jenna Sacks speak with Jessica about strategies for managing periods of high growth. They examine when you should promote internally and hire externally as well as discuss successful interview processes. Jessica also offers us a window into her teams' structures. She explains the relationships between her account development representatives and her account executives and the ways account based marketing has helped her organization. Customer Success Journeys With Emilia D’Anzica

25m · Published 22 Feb 05:00
Emilia D’Anzica is the founder of Growth Molecules, LLC, a company of growth revenue advisors who deliver data-driven customer success strategies to enable teams and customers. Join Emilia and co-hosts Jeremey Donovan and Jenna Sacks as they dive into Emilia’s experiences building customer success teams. They discuss essential customer success metrics everyone in SaaS should know, techniques to facilitate an executive business review, and the importance of prioritizing customer success early.
